hq720.jpgKinds of Daycares:
There are many different types of daycares readily available, each catering to various needs and tastes. Some typically common types of daycares include:

  1. In-home Daycares: These are typically operate by an individual or household in their own personal home. They feature a far more personal setting with a lesser child-to-caregiver proportion.

  1. Childcare facilities: they are larger facilities that serve a more substantial wide range of young ones. They may provide more structured programs and tasks.

  1. Preschools: they're comparable to childcare centers but focus more on early education and school readiness.

  1. Montessori institutes: These schools follow the Montessori method of education, which emphasizes independency, self-directed learning, and hands-on activities.

Expenses:
The price of daycare can vary depending on the sort of daycare, location, and solutions supplied. Some aspects that can influence the expense of Daycare Near Me (source for this article) include:

  1. Form of daycare: In-home daycares might be cheaper than childcare centers or preschools.

  1. Place: Daycares in urban areas or high-cost-of-living areas could have greater charges.

  1. Providers supplied: Daycares that offer additional services, such as early training programs or dishes, might have greater charges.

  1. Subsidies: Some people may be entitled to subsidies or financial assist with assist protect the price of daycare.
